Position Overview:
The Global Procurement team drives Micron's growth. It delivers outstanding total cost and supply chain resiliency with modern predictive capabilities risk analysis and attention to sustainability and diversity. Our business goals are directly tied to the value we place on our team members - our greatest asset and we invest in our people through a skills-based learning and development model to create clear career pathways while fostering an engaging and inclusive culture. As a Supply Management Analyst in the Inbound Supply Management team at Micron your primary responsibility will be to ensure availability and continuity of supply and implement a comprehensive inventory management strategy while engaging suppliers and partners to resolve shortages and build resilience.
Responsibilities:
- Develop monitor and optimize inventory replenishment models and supply execution strategies to effectively support manufacturing and minimize waste including forecast and material requirements planning (MRP) safety stock (SS) reorder point (ROP) and lead time maintenance as well as part/material obsolescence management
- Manage supplier commitments monitor forecast accuracy and work with suppliers and business partners to address any concerns in demand volume and timing
- Manage inventory scheduling delivery and make order adjustments with suppliers as necessary and expedite and elevate delivery issues as needed to ensure continuity of supply
- Address inventory shortage issues and resolve root cause
- Work with direct and cross-functional teams to implement and complete global strategic direction in supply fulfillment and inventory management

Micron Technology Compensation & Benefits Highlights
- Retirement Support—The RAM 401(k) plan provides a dollar‑for‑dollar company match up to 5% of eligible pay with automatic enrollment and escalation. After‑tax contributions and in‑plan Roth conversions add flexibility for additional savings.
- Healthcare Strength—Multiple medical plan options with HSA/FSA support mental‑health resources and wellness programs are documented. Access to the Micron Family Health Center at Boise for enrollees adds onsite care in certain locations.
- Equity Value & Accessibility—An Employee Stock Purchase Plan enables purchases of company stock at a 15% discount in multiple regions. Company materials also reference equity participation reinforcing employee ownership opportunities.
